佛珠吊兰 is a special variety among succulents, with leaves that are round little beads, known as珍珠吊兰 or 佛珠吊兰. These little beads are plump and green, with translucent round leaves resembling pearls. Many people choose to grow them, often using them as a hanging plant, and some even grow them as curtains. If you don't prune or pinch the tips, its branches will continue to grow, potentially reaching several meters in length. How can you care for 佛珠吊兰 effectively to make it thrive and become bushy?

As a succulent plant, 佛珠吊兰 requires good soil for maintenance. It's best not to use too small a pot. Generally, particle soil should make up at least half, with nutrient-rich soil making up the other half, mixed in a 1:1 ratio, ensuring the soil is breathable, water-permeable, and nutrient-rich. To care for 佛珠吊兰 well, adequate light is essential. In spring, autumn, and winter, it needs plenty of sunlight. In summer, it must be shaded as it goes into a dormant state. Shading is necessary, as insufficient shading could increase its energy consumption, as we dare not water it.

How to water it? Watering 佛珠吊兰 is very simple. When the soil is completely dry, water thoroughly. In spring, autumn, and winter, as long as the temperature can be maintained around 15 degrees, water it when the soil is dry. In summer, absolutely do not water it, as it is in a dormant state. Watering then will lead to root and stem rot. Keeping the soil dry, the little beads may retract and shrink, which is a normal phenomenon. Once autumn arrives, watering and fertilizing adequately will help it quickly recover its fullness and growth.

How to fertilize it? In spring, autumn, and winter, which are its growing seasons, choose a fertilizer high in nitrogen content with other elements as well, opting for a water-soluble type. Fertilize it 2 to 3 times a month, sprinkle multi-element slow-release fertilizer on the surface of the soil, or use some well-fermented sheep manure. Make sure to ensure good ventilation. By doing this, you can grow a pot of珍珠吊兰 with plump and round beads, with branches that can grow several meters long, making it thrive and avoiding root rot or decay. In summer, ensure good ventilation, do not water, do not apply fertilizer, keep the leaves from getting wet in the rain, and do not spray them with a spray bottle, so it can safely survive the summer and grow rapidly in the growing season.
